Hướng dẫn Arduino Mega – Sơ đồ chân

Sơ đồ chân Arduino Mega

Trong bài viết này, chúng ta sẽ tìm hiểu về Arduino Mega 2560 và sơ đồ chân của nó. Arduino Mega 2560 được sử dụng vì những tính năng bổ sung mà nó mang lại. Với 16 đầu dò analog và 54 đầu dò kỹ thuật số, Arduino Mega 2560 cung cấp khả năng giao tiếp và kiểm soát cao hơn. Nó cũng tích hợp các tính năng như RTC, bộ so sánh tương tự và chế độ tiết kiệm điện. Đồng thời, tốc độ xử lý nhanh và độ chính xác cao của Arduino Mega 2560 giúp nó trở thành sự lựa chọn lý tưởng cho các ứng dụng phức tạp.

Thông số kỹ thuật Arduino Mega 2560

Arduino Mega 2560 sử dụng vi điều khiển AVR ATmega 2560 với nguồn cấp từ 7-12V. Nó có tổng cộng 70 chân I/O, bao gồm 54 chân I/O kỹ thuật số và 16 chân I/O analog. Tốc độ đồng hồ của Arduino Mega 2560 là 16 MHz và bộ nhớ flash là 128 KB, SRAM là 8 KB.

Giao tiếp của Arduino Mega 2560 bao gồm USB, ICSP, SPI, I2C và USART.

Sơ đồ chân Arduino Mega

Arduino Mega – Tính năng nâng cao

Arduino Mega 2560 cung cấp nhiều tính năng nâng cao cho các ứng dụng phức tạp hơn. Điều này bao gồm 6 bộ đếm thời gian, 12 chân PWM, 16 chân ADC và 4 chân USART. Ngoài ra, Arduino Mega 2560 còn tích hợp bộ so sánh tương tự, ngắt ngoài, chế độ tiết kiệm điện và cảm biến nhiệt độ.

Sơ đồ chân Arduino Mega

Sơ đồ chân Arduino Mega

Sơ đồ chân của Arduino Mega giúp bạn hiểu rõ vị trí và chức năng của từng chân. Dưới đây là mô tả của một số chân quan trọng trên Arduino Mega:

  • Chân nguồn:

    • VIN: Điện áp cung cấp (7-12V)
    • GND: Đất
    • Nguồn cung cấp 5V: Đối với nguồn điện thiết bị phần cứng bên ngoài
    • Cung cấp 3.3V: Đối với nguồn điện thiết bị phần cứng điện áp thấp bên ngoài
  • Chân điều khiển:

    • RESET: Chân đặt lại, được sử dụng để đặt lại bộ điều khiển
    • XTAL1, XTAL2: Chân kết nối với tinh thể (16MHz) cung cấp đồng hồ cho bộ điều khiển
    • AREF: Chân được sử dụng để chọn điện áp tham chiếu cho ADC
  • Chân kỹ thuật số:

    • Sử dụng làm đầu vào hoặc đầu ra cho các thiết bị kỹ thuật số
    • Điều khiển các thiết bị như đèn LED, cảm biến siêu âm, bộ mã hóa quay
  • Chân tương tự:

    • Sử dụng làm đầu vào tương tự cho ADC
    • Điều khiển các thiết bị như nút nhấn, cảm biến nhiệt độ
  • Chân SPI:

    • Sử dụng cho giao tiếp nối tiếp với các thiết bị khác như LCD và thẻ SD
  • Chân I2C:

    • Sử dụng cho giao tiếp hai dây với các thiết bị khác như LCD, RTC
  • Chân PWM:

    • Sử dụng làm đầu ra PWM để điều khiển tốc độ động cơ, độ sáng đèn
  • Chân USART:

    • Sử dụng cho giao tiếp nối tiếp với máy tính hoặc các thiết bị khác
  • Chân ngắt phần cứng:

    • Sử dụng cho các chức năng ngắt phần cứng như nút nhấn, cảm biến

Sơ đồ chân Arduino Mega

Arduino Mega 2560 là một trong những phiên bản Arduino phổ biến và mạnh mẽ. Với sự phong phú về tính năng và khả năng mở rộng, nó là công cụ lý tưởng cho các dự án từ cơ bản đến phức tạp.

FEATURED TOPIC

hihi